Category: Cafés - Paris Restaurants
Address: 139, rue St-Dominique, Paris 75007
Proust had his madeleines but Chef Christian Constant has a chalkboard menu full of memories at the Café Constant. The casual atmosphere of this dimunitive corner café complements the hearty, old fashioned meals that include a signature veal "Cordon Bleu" and such tempting treats as profiteroles and creme caramel....
Category: Wine, Cheese & Caviar - Paris Restaurants
Address: 17, pl. de la Madeleine, Paris 75008
Caviar Kaspia offers great decor and caviars that imitate Russian varieties from the 1800s. Aficionados are especially pleased to sample from the selection, which includes sevruga, geluga and ossetra. The extensive wine list carries an appropriate vintage to accent any appetizer or meal you choose. METRO: Madeleine
Category: French Traditional - Paris Restaurants
Address: 5, rue Coq Héron, Paris 75001
Fresh, seasonal ingredients contribute to the fabulous cuisine produced by Chef Gérard Besson. Known for his wonderful game, Besson serves braised hare in rich brown sauce and chicken fricassee with sweetbreads or foie gras and oyster flan.
